Dennis Gabor was born on June 5, 1900 in Budapest, Hungary. After serving in World War I, he studied in Hungary. After studying he became a British citizen in 1946, and invented holography in 1947 while working at British Thomson-Houston. His contribution as an inventor made him very famous that the Hungarian Academy of Sciences gives awards on Gabor’s name to young scientists. He received the first Nobel Prize for the invention of holography in 1971.


Holography is a capacity that allows the light scattered from an object to be recorded and later reproduced. Holography is also used in 3D and science fiction movies where an object appears to be present when actually, it’s not. The light is the key - without the light you cannot see the image.
